Due to a problem of software of Samsung download many of my contacts in windows mail has been copied several times. I need to remove hundreds of duplicate contacts. Will never delete one at a time. Can you advise how to highlight that both 30 and remove at once? Thank you

These keystrokes work in most lists in Windows:

  1. Click on an item to select it;
  2. Click on an item to select it, hold CTRL and click on either one to be selected at a time;
  3. Click on an item to select it, hold the SHIFT key and click another to select both and everything in the meantime;
  4. Click on an item to select it, hold CTRL and press A to select all the items.
Press DELETE to remove the selection.
 
You will find it easier to select multiple items in the Contacts folder, if you select view > Details.

    Recently changed ISPS but currently have two active accounts.  I would like to import/transfer saved messages and folders, and all contacts from the old account to the new account before the cancellation of the old account.  Both are configured through Windows mail.

    In Windows Mail, messages, folders, and contacts are not related to any specific email account, so remove your old account won't affect.  To check that, I just removed all my Windows Mail accounts on a Windows Vista-based computer that I use for testing.  Messages, folders, and contacts are always there.

    To be safe, you could back up the Windows Mail storage folder before deleting an account.

    Windows Live Mail works differently and requires copy/move messages before deleting an account. Boulder computer Maven

    Is it possible to have too many Windows Mail and Windows Live Mail installed on a Dell Vista computer?  I have Windows Mail to a business e-mail and want to download Windows Live Mail for personal use.  When I go tohttp://explore.live.com/windows-live-mail it does give me an option to upgrade that I assume will be completely removed from my Windows Mail program.  Is is possible to download the Live Mail without remove/upgrade the small Windows Mail?

    Windows Live Mail can run along the coast of WinMail without problem.

    Windows Live Mail (presentation, features & download)
    http://get.live.com/wlmail/overview

    If this download offers a upgrade, check in Control Panel | Add/Remove programs and look for Windows Live Essentials. Perhaps it is already installed and you are not aware.

    Download and set up WLMail will not remove WinMail or its content. It may become the default program and it can import your messages and contacts, but WinMail is not assigned the case. All messages or imported files can be deleted if desired.

    Using windows mail for more than a year on the same computer and now I can no longer send emails. I always receive.

    This is the message I get.

    Your server suddenly put an end to the connection. The possible causes for this include server problems, network problems, or a long period of inactivity.

    Subject 'test '.
    Server: 'smtp.att.yahoo.com '.
    Windows Live Mail error ID: 0x800CCC0F
    Protocol: SMTP
    Port: 465
    Secure (SSL): Yes

    With the help of a care antivirus
    Have had 3 sessions of troubleshooting with AT & T and they tell me now that there is a problem with my windows mail. I downloaded windows live mail to see if I could use it instead, and he's done the same thing. I did system restore to the day before I started to have problems, but that no longer works.

    From: Gary van

    This problem is due to a recent update of OneCare. To resolve this issue in Windows Mail: click on tools, Options, security, digital IDs. On the personal tab, you will see a digital ID. Select it and click Remove.
    Restart Windows Mail and try to send.
